Leasing Agent resumes often get buried in routine task descriptions that hiring managers already expect. Instead of listing daily responsibilities, showcase the measurable impact you created through tenant relationships, occupancy improvements, and revenue growth that directly benefited your property management company.
"Responsible for leasing apartments" → "Increased occupancy rates" → Quantify your leasing success with specific percentages, average days to lease, or occupancy improvements you achieved compared to previous periods or property benchmarks.
"Handled tenant complaints" → "Resolved resident concerns proactively" → Detail how you prevented lease breaks, improved tenant satisfaction scores, or implemented solutions that reduced recurring maintenance issues.
"Showed apartments to prospects" → "Converted prospects into signed leases" → Include your conversion rate, average lease values, or how you exceeded monthly leasing targets through effective sales techniques.
"Maintained property records" → "Streamlined leasing operations" → Highlight process improvements you made to application processing, move-in procedures, or documentation systems that saved time or reduced errors.

Don't waste resume space describing leasing agent day-to-day workflows. Focus on what changed because of your specific contributions. Most job descriptions signal they want to see leasing agents with resume bullet points that show ownership, drive, and impact, not just list responsibilities.
Use clear action verbs and add context that shows the before and after. Write "Increased occupancy rate from 85% to 96% by implementing targeted follow-up system" instead of "Conducted property tours." Quantify your tenant retention improvements, lease conversion rates, and revenue growth. Show how you solved problems or improved processes beyond basic leasing duties.

How to format a Leasing Agent skills section
Leasing Agent positions once prioritized basic customer service, but 2025 employers demand digital proficiency and data-driven results. Modern hiring managers seek candidates who blend traditional relationship-building abilities with advanced property technology expertise and measurable performance outcomes.
Match technical skills from job descriptions, especially property management software like Yardi, RentManager, or AppFolio systems for daily operations.
Highlight customer relationship management abilities alongside specific metrics like occupancy rates or lease conversion percentages you've consistently achieved.
Include digital marketing skills such as social media management, virtual tour creation, or online listing optimization for competitive property positioning.
Emphasize compliance knowledge by listing relevant certifications, fair housing training, or local rental law familiarity you currently possess.
Balance soft skills like negotiation and communication with hard skills like financial analysis or comprehensive market research capabilities.

Resume FAQs for Leasing Agents
How long should I make my Leasing Agent resume?
In today's competitive property management market, hiring managers typically spend just 6-8 seconds scanning each resume. For Leasing Agents, a one-page resume is ideal in 2025, particularly for those with less than 10 years of experience. This concise format forces you to highlight only your most relevant leasing achievements and property management skills. Those with extensive experience managing multiple properties or specialized portfolios may extend to two pages, but no longer. Be ruthless. Prioritize recent leasing experience, measurable results (like occupancy rates or lease renewal percentages), and property management software proficiency. Use bullet points strategically to showcase your tenant relations skills and leasing conversion rates.
What is the best way to format a Leasing Agent resume?
Property management hiring managers are looking for organized, detail-oriented professionals who can handle multiple responsibilities. Choose a clean, modern format with clearly defined sections and consistent formatting throughout. Start with a targeted summary highlighting your leasing expertise and tenant satisfaction record. Follow with core competencies that align with the job description, such as CRM software proficiency, sales techniques, and tenant screening. Your experience section should emphasize quantifiable achievements like occupancy improvements, lease renewal rates, and sales targets met. Include property types and unit counts. Keep it scannable. Use bold headings and adequate white space to improve readability for busy property managers reviewing multiple applications.
What certifications should I include on my Leasing Agent resume?
The property management industry increasingly values formal credentials alongside practical experience. The National Apartment Association's Certified Apartment Leasing Professional (CALP) remains the gold standard in 2025, demonstrating your commitment to leasing best practices and tenant relations. Additionally, a Fair Housing Certification shows your understanding of critical compliance issues. For tech-savvy candidates, certifications in property management software like Yardi, RealPage, or AppFolio significantly boost marketability. List these prominently in a dedicated "Certifications" section near the top of your resume. If you're pursuing but haven't completed a certification, include it as "In Progress" with the anticipated completion date to show professional development commitment.
What are the most common resume mistakes to avoid as a Leasing Agent?
Leasing Agent resumes often fall short by focusing too heavily on job duties rather than achievements. Many candidates list generic responsibilities without quantifying their impact on occupancy rates, tenant satisfaction, or revenue generation. Fix this by including specific metrics: "Increased occupancy from 82% to 96% within 6 months" or "Maintained 92% lease renewal rate." Another common pitfall is neglecting to highlight sales skills. Leasing is fundamentally a sales position. Demonstrate your ability to convert prospects into tenants with concrete examples. Finally, many resumes lack property-specific details. Include property types, unit counts, and price points you've worked with. This context matters. Tailor each application to the specific property management company.
